Lavern G. Pittman-Newsom, Jr.

LAKEWOOD, Colo. — Services for Lavern Gene Pittman-Newsom, Jr., 22, will be at 10 a.m. on Tuesday, March 15 at Rollie Mortuary Palm Chapel. Gene Clark will officiate. Burial will be in Mt. Olivet Cemetery in Wheat Ridge, Colo.

Survivors include his father, Lavern Newsom, Sr. of Gallup; mother, Theresa Newsom of Lakewood; sister, Arlyss Marie Newsom of Phoenix; grandmothers, Beulah Donoho of Tenn., Arlyss Newsom of Gallup; grandfathers, Pat Donoho of Tenn., Howard Newsom of Gallup and Clinton Pittman of Ore.

Rollie Mortuary is in charge of arrangements.


Buster A. Villani

LAS VEGAS, Nev. — Buster A. Villani, 85, died Feb. 25 in Las Vegas, Nev. He was born Dec. 25, 1919 in Berwind, Colo.

Villani served in the US Air Force during WWII, in the Pacific Theatre. He moved to Gallup in 1946 and was employed with Gurley Motors prior to retirement. Villani was a member of the Gallup Elks Club, Knights of Columbus, Veterans of Foreign Wars, Yeis, and the Gallup High School Boster Club.

Survivors include his wife, Della of Las Vegas; son, Tony of Dallas; daughter, Vicky of Las Vegas and two grandchildren.

Villani was preceded in death by his sister, Flora Guadagnoli. Interment was in the Las Vegas, Nev. on March 1.
